Awning Windows Installation in Boston, MA
Awning window installation involves fitting a type of window that hinges at the top, allowing it to open outward from the bottom. These windows are commonly used in various projects, including adding natural light and ventilation to living rooms, kitchens, basements, or sunrooms. Property owners often choose awning windows for their ability to provide privacy and airflow even during light rain, making them suitable for both new constructions and replacement projects. Before requesting installation services, homeowners typically want to understand the size and style options available, as well as how the windows will complement the overall design of their property.
When considering awning window installation, property owners should evaluate factors such as window placement, accessibility, and the existing structure’s compatibility. It’s important to determine whether the current framing can support the new windows or if modifications are needed. Additionally, understanding the energy efficiency features and maintenance requirements of different window models can help in making an informed decision. Proper preparation and clear communication about project goals can contribute to a smooth installation process and ensure the finished result meets the property's needs.

Awning Windows Installation Questions
What are the benefits of awning windows? Awning windows provide natural light, ventilation, and can be opened even during rain, making them a practical choice for many homes.
Where are awning windows typically installed? They are often installed in basements, bathrooms, or above kitchen sinks to enhance airflow while maintaining privacy and security.
What materials are available for awning window frames? Common options include vinyl, aluminum, and wood, each offering different durability and aesthetic qualities.
What should homeowners consider before installing awning windows? It's important to evaluate the window placement, size, and how they will complement the property's overall style and functionality.
